John Singer Sargent’s “Moraine” isn't merely a landscape painting; it’s an embodiment of Victorian grandeur filtered through Impressionistic sensitivity. Completed in 1909, this canvas—measuring 55 x 69 cm—captures the austere beauty of Snowdonia National Park, Wales, transforming a seemingly simple vista into a profound meditation on geological time and artistic vision.
The painting's historical context speaks to the burgeoning interest in scientific exploration during Sargent’s era. Snowdonia was becoming increasingly popular with Victorian tourists eager to witness its dramatic landscapes, mirroring a broader fascination with geological phenomena and the sublime—the awe-inspiring grandeur of nature that inspires contemplation.
Symbolism: Beyond its depiction of a specific location, “Moraine” carries symbolic weight. The starkness of the mountainscape represents resilience and permanence against the ephemeral beauty of light and color. Sargent’s deliberate use of muted tones—primarily blues and greys—creates an atmosphere of serenity and contemplation, inviting viewers to consider the passage of time and the enduring power of natural forces.
Emotional Impact: “Moraine” transcends mere visual representation; it evokes a feeling of profound stillness. The painting’s subtle luminescence captures the magic of dawn or dusk—moments when light transforms ordinary landscapes into canvases of ethereal beauty. It's a testament to Sargent’s ability to translate emotion onto canvas, resonating with viewers who appreciate art that speaks to the soul.
A masterpiece of Impressionism, "Moraine" exemplifies Sargent's unwavering commitment to capturing the essence of his subjects—a feat achieved through masterful brushwork and a profound understanding of light and color. It remains an enduring symbol of Victorian grandeur and artistic innovation.
